Safety is the most crucial feature in any bunk bed or loft bed. The frame should be constructed from solid, high-quality wood and the stairs or ladder should be securely fastened to the bed. In addition, the bunk bed should have railings for the upper floor to prevent your children from falling and hurting themselves.

If your child prefers climbing up a ladder before bed it is possible to think about bunk beds that have stairs. Staircases take up more room however they are safer for children who are less experienced and cannot quite reach the top bunk without a ladder. They also let parents easily reach the top bunk if they have to wake their children or read their children a bedtime tale.

Stairs can be movable or fixed according to the kind of bunk bed you choose to purchase. Some have the ladder set on the short end of the bunk, which Fenton states is a better option as it allows you to put furniture or storage underneath the bunk without obstructing access to the ladder. Some bunks come with ladders that can be moved to either the left or right side. Both options have pros and cons. Consider what would best suit your family before you make a decision.

A lot of bunk beds with stairs also come with a full-over-twin or twin-over-full mattress, making them ideal for siblings sharing the bedroom or for families who regularly host sleepovers. A lot of models have built-in trundle beds to allow for additional guests without taking up precious floor space in the room.

If you decide to use either ladders or stairs, be sure you choose high-quality materials and a style that matches your child's personality and the design of the rest of the room. It is also important to know the weight limits for every mattress to ensure your child isn't too heavy for the bunks, since exceeding these guidelines can compromise the safety of your child. It is also important to measure the floor space to ensure the bunks will fit, and ideally leave a few inches between the frame and the wall to prevent tripping.
